Specifications
Series: | FS |
Packaging: | Tape & Box (TB) |
Lead Free Status / RoHS Status: | -- |
Part Status: | Active |
Capacitance: | 680µF |
Tolerance: | ±20% |
Voltage - Rated: | 63V |
ESR (Equivalent Series Resistance): | -- |
Lifetime @ Temp.: | 10000 Hrs @ 105°C |
Operating Temperature: | -40°C ~ 105°C |
Polarization: | Polar |
Ratings: | -- |
Applications: | General Purpose |
Ripple Current @ Low Frequency: | 1.61475A @ 120Hz |
Ripple Current @ High Frequency: | 2.153A @ 100kHz |
Impedance: | 29 mOhms |
Lead Spacing: | 0.295" (7.50mm) |
Size / Dimension: | 0.630" Dia (16.00mm) |
Height - Seated (Max): | 0.807" (20.50mm) |
Surface Mount Land Size: | -- |
Mounting Type: | Through Hole |
Package / Case: | Radial, Can |
